Love Peppers best Italian restaurant in Northeastern Ohio. Family owned and operated, You can eat in or carry out. The food is excellent, the dining room servers are courteous and the kitchen staff is on top of it, NEVER disappointed with the service or the food! The home made GRAPE PIE IS FANTASTIC! The TIRAMISU just melts in your mouth, Yum yum!!!